Top 5 Best Saeed Ajmal Bowling Performances

Saeed Ajmal played international cricket for Pakistan from 2008-2015. He played 35 Test Matches for Pakistan and took 178 test wickets. Here we take a look at his top 5 best bowling performances.

If we are talking about great spinners of the modern era we can’t not talk about Saeed Ajmal who was one of the best and most difficult spinners to face in international cricket. Saeed Ajmal was the best spinner for Pakistan for a number of years and he was a bowler I loved to watch bowl and he picked a lot of wickets for Pakistan as well. We will talk about his records below.


Saeed Ajmal played international cricket for Pakistan from 2008-2015 and in only those 7 years he made a unique name for himself so much so that he is talked about in glowing terms still. He played 35 Test Matches for Pakistan and he took 178 test wickets which is more than 5 wickets per match at a very good average of 28.11 with 10 Five wicket hauls and 4 times he has taken 10 wickets in a test match. He also played 113 ODIs for Pakistan and he got 184 wickets at an astonishing average of 22.73 with 2 Five wicket hauls In his ODI career. He also picked up 85 wickets in T20IS for Pakistan in 64 Matches. So, let’s look at his Top 5 Best Performances


7/55 vs England (2012)


One of his best ever test bowling performances came against England in 2012 when he was at the peak of his bowling prowess and England bore the brunt of it. England were batting first in this test match and Saeed Ajmal tore apart the batting line-up and got a huge 7 wicket haul and giving away just 55 runs in 24.3 overs and as a result England were all out for 192 and Pakistan won this test match by 10 wickets. It was an exhibition of great spin bowling by one of the best.

6/96 vs South Africa (2013)


I have included this incredible performance because of where it came at, it came at Cape Town which is not know for spin bowling and for Saeed Ajmal to go there and take 6 wickets In the first innings and set an example of how Asian Bowlers should bowl to get spin in overseas conditions. Pakistan may have lost that match but this performance from Saeed Ajmal where he gave away 96 runs in 42 overs and took 6 wickets will be one of his best ever.

7/95 and 4/23 vs Zimbabwe (2013)


This was just a brutal reality check for Zimbabwe as to how it feels facing top quality spin bowling and they were simply blown away in this test match and just because it is Zimbabwe that does not mean I will ignore this 11 wicket match haul for Saeed Ajmal. Saeed Ajmal bowled 32.3 overs in the first innings and took 7 wickets for 95 runs and when it mattered most in the 4th innings he took 4 wickets for just 23 runs and Pakistan won that match by 221 runs in the end and it was another man of the match for the great Saeed Ajmal.

4/32 vs Australia (2012)


This was one of the best ODI bowling performances in the career of Saeed Ajmal where he led the bowling attack of Pakistan to get a big win vs Australia. Australia were batting first in this ODI match and Saeed Ajmal took 4 important Wickets to stop the flow of runs and he Bowled 10 overs and just gave away runs at 3.2 runs per over and as a result of his excellent bowling Pakistan won this match by 7 wickets where all the other bowlers were going for runs. This was a special performance from a special player.

5/24 vs India (2013)


If there was a low scoring thriller it was this one in Delhi in 2013 and Saeed Ajmal got his best ODI bowling performance that day when he got 5 Wickets for only 24 runs in 9.4 overs at 2.48 runs per over. Saeed Ajmal showed that day that he should be feared by all the batters in the world but that day India won that match by 10 runs as Pakistan were bowled out for 157 but that does not take away from what an incredible bowling spell that was.
